The Historical Context of Window Technologies in the UK

Traditional UK homes, especially Victorian and Edwardian structures, predominantly featured timber-framed sash windows, valued for their aesthetic charm but often challenged by insulation limitations. As energy efficiency standards tightened and building regulations evolved post-World War II, materials such as uPVC and aluminium gained prominence, offering durability and low maintenance. The shift also reflected a broader societal push towards sustainability, with energy-efficient glazing becoming a central focus.

Technological Advancements Shaping the Industry

Innovation Impact & Benefits Examples
Triple Glazing Enhanced thermal insulation, reducing heating costs and carbon footprint. High-performance units in new builds in colder UK regions.
Smart Windows Integrated sensors and tinting capabilities for adaptive control of natural light and heat. Emerging in luxury developments and high-end renovations.
Minimal Frames & Slimline Profiles Maximized natural light, unobstructed views, and contemporary aesthetic appeal. Modern city apartments and minimalist homes.

Regulatory Standards and Consumer Expectations

The UK’s building regulations, particularly Document L (Conservation of Fuel and Power), mandate stringent thermal performance, encouraging innovations in glazing and framing materials. Furthermore, the trend towards Passivhaus standards underscores a demand for near-zero energy buildings, with windows playing a pivotal role in achieving such benchmarks.
